Because of the conditions necessary to transform rocks, those being heat and pressure, the process usually occurs deep within the Earth’s crust, or in areas where tectonic plates collide. Web30 nov. 2024 · Metamorphism is the process by which mineral and structural changes are formed in solid rocks in response to their present physical and chemical conditions, which vary from those under which the rocks were originally formed. Temperature, pressure, and fluids are the most important factors of metamorphism. WebThe majority of gemstones are formed by metamorphism.
